One of the hardest parts right now—beyond the hunger and the bombs—is the complete lack of cash in Gaza.

There’s no money in the streets. People can’t buy food even when it’s available.
But why?

Here’s what’s happening:

Organized looters—many believe backed, encouraged, or at the very least protected by the Israeli army—wait for food trucks to make it through the border. If the food gets in at all, these groups intercept it. They steal the aid, then resell it at outrageous prices.

But it doesn’t end there.

These looters don’t use the cash—they just hoard it.
They don’t need to buy food—they’ll steal another truck tomorrow.
So they take the little cash left in Gaza and pull it out of circulation.

The result?

Families can’t buy food.
Markets collapse.
And if someone abroad—say a relative in the U.S.—wants to send help, the cost of getting money into Gaza has skyrocketed.

What used to cost a horrific 25% fee now demands up to 45%.
That's nearly half the money gone before it even reaches the person who needs it.
